Own periodical reconciliation and analysis of book and tax basis fixed assets across global entities, ensuring compliance and optimization of tax cost recovery computations.
Lead and support global tax fixed asset initiatives including process improvements, digitalization, automation, and standardization efforts to enhance tax depreciation processes and maximize efficiencies.
Collaborate across tax accounting, compliance teams, and external consultants globally, including supporting US tax accounting and compliance activities and driving cross-functional and ad hoc tax projects.
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related business discipline; MBA preferred.
Enrolled Agent (EA) certification mandatory.
Minimum 6 years relevant tax operations experience with exposure to fixed assets and cost recovery processes.
Willingness to support working hours approximately 3:00 PM to 12:00 AM IST (US time zone support).
Experienced in global tax compliance including US federal and state frameworks with strong analytical and project management skills.
Proven ability to drive tax technology and digital transformation initiatives in complex, high-impact assignments.
Capable of working cross-functionally and managing multiple priorities in dynamic, geographically dispersed teams under pressure.
